https://www.collierescue.org/dogs/8 NAPERVILLE, IL Kirby is a gentle, mahogany sable Rough Collie who brings a calm, comforting presence to any room. This mellow, house-trained senior girl loves staying close to her people and would thrive in a quiet home that can support her slower pace and mobility needs. Kirby is a 11-year-old Rough Collie whose sweetness and easygoing nature shine through in everything she does. She’s fully house trained, rarely vocal, and content with a simple routine that includes short, regular walks and plenty of couch time. Kirby prefers to stay near her adults, soaking up gentle affection and companionship rather than high-energy play. She’s learning to loosen up and play a bit from her foster siblings, but her favorite role is quiet, loyal shadow. Due to significant muscle loss in her rear legs, Kirby has difficulty with stairs and getting up, so she needs a home that can accommodate her mobility challenges. She’s doing better with supportive care and supplements, but still benefits from a safe, stable environment where she can move at her own pace. A fenced yard is always desirable but she doesn’t require it as long as she gets age-appropriate exercise. Kirby moves carefully around seniors and would be an ideal match for a calm, patient household ready to offer her comfort, consistency, and love in her golden years.

Fenced yard required Fostered near Britton, MI https://www.collierescue.org/dogs/2054 https://www.collierescue.org/adopt/apply Murray is a smart, energetic, and affectionate young Collie with a big personality and love for his people. He enjoys treats, toys, and a good game of fetch, and he’s always eager to learn, making him a rewarding match for an active home that can offer structure, playtime, and continued guidance as he grows into the wonderful companion he is meant to be. This handsome boy is fully housebroken, comfortable in a crate, and settles well when left alone. He has learned not to destroy his toys, is improving with waiting at doors, and comes when called. Murray is highly intelligent and loves to learn—he even figured out how to let himself back inside by using a lever-style doorknob! Murray thrives on attention and affection. He loves to be part of whatever his family is doing. One of his favorite things is greeting his foster mom with morning snuggles. He responds well to treats, chews, toys, and calm, consistent routines. He navigates stairs with ease and has done well with grooming after overcoming his initial fear of the high-velocity dryer. Murray gets along well with other dogs and cats. He enjoys canine companionship but is still learning appropriate play manners and can be a bit exuberant at times. A family willing to provide supervision, structure, and continued guidance will help him continue making great progress. Because Murray can be sensitive to certain sights and sounds outside of the fence, he would do best in a quieter environment with minimal outside distractions. A dog savvy, active home with a securely fenced yard, clear expectations, and plenty of physical and mental enrichment will be ideal for this bright young Collie. Murray is a happy, affectionate Collie who is ready to share his heart with a family of his own. With continued guidance, patience, and love, he will grow into a wonderful companion and a loyal best friend for years to come.
